What is Employee Work Profile

The Employee Work Profile Form is a document used by the Department of Juvenile Justice to evaluate and document work responsibilities, performance, and development plans of security officers.

Comprehensive Guide to Employee Work Profile

What is the Employee Work Profile Form?

The Employee Work Profile Form serves a crucial purpose in documenting employee performance and duties. Particularly for security officers in the Department of Juvenile Justice, this form is significant as it encapsulates essential details such as position identification and performance plans. Typically, supervisors or HR professionals fill it out, aiming to communicate an employee's performance to upper management.

Purpose and Benefits of the Employee Work Profile Form

This form offers multiple advantages in employee management. It aids in evaluating an employee's contributions and planning their development through tailored performance plans. Furthermore, the form enhances accountability and sets performance standards through formal documentation, which is critical in HR processes.

Key Features of the Employee Work Profile Form

The Employee Work Profile Form is designed to be user-friendly and official. Key sections include:
  • Work description.
  • Performance plan.
  • Development plan.
Additionally, the form features fillable fields and requires signatures from the employee, supervisor, and reviewer, ensuring authenticity. Security and compliance measures are also highlighted, which are vital in the filling and submission process.
